Rube Waddell Biography

  • George Edward "Rube" Waddell (October 13, – April 1, ) was an American pitcher in Major League Baseball (MLB). A left-hander, he played for 13 years, with the Louisville Colonels, Pittsburgh Pirates, and Chicago Orphans in the National League, as well as the Philadelphia Athletics and St. Louis Browns See more.
